The chat window that allows two Residents to have a private conversation with each other.

Opposed to open chat, which is limited to a distance of 20 meter, instant messages (often abbrivated as IMs) reach grid wide. The length of an IM is limited to 1023 bytes/single-byte characters.

When a Resident is offline, up to 25 instant messages will be stored and delivered at the next login. This limit includes inventory offers, group notices, group invitation and IMs. All messages above this group limit will be capped and not delivered.

However, there is an IM to Email feature, which sends offline messages directly to the mailbox connected to your account. To activate it, go to Edit > Preferences (or press Ctrl-P), go to the Communication tab and check the Send IM to Email checkbox. Press Apply and close the window with OK.

When an offline message is received via Email, this message can also be answered via Email again. These mails will be converted back to IM and sent to the right Resident. Note that the Email to IM feature expires after 5 days after the receival of the IM. Messages sent afterwards won't be received anymore. Also note that the length of properly delivered Email replies is limited to 1023 bytes/single-byte characters. Messages exceeding this limited will be truncated to fit the limit.
